The one thing which I shall not tell you is WHY I killed him.

But it was a sufficient reason." He saw the shuddering tremor that swept through the shoulders of the girl who was putting down the condemning notes.
"And you refuse to confess your motive ?" "Absolutely--except that he had wronged me in a way that deserved death." "And you make this confession knowing that you are about to die ?" The flicker of a smile passed over Kent's lips.

He looked at O'Connor and for an instant saw in O'Connor's eyes a flash of their old comradeship.
"Yes.

Dr.Cardigan has told me.

Otherwise I should have let the man in the guard-house hang.
